ORGANIC SEMICONDUCTOR SOLUTION AND ORGANIC SEMICONDUCTOR FILM
申请人:TEIJIN LIMITED
公开号:US20150236269A1
公开(公告)日:2015-08-20
The present invention provides an organic semiconductor solution that can produce an organic semiconductor film having acceptable semiconductor properties while endowed with improved film-forming properties due to substantial polymer content. This organic semiconductor solution contains an organic solvent as well as a polymer and an organic semiconductor precursor dissolved in the organic solvent. The proportion of the polymer in relation to the total of the polymer and the organic semiconductor precursor is equal to or greater than 3 mass %.
